New Japan Pro Wrestling recently announced the full card for their All Star Junior Festival event on March 1st in Tokyo, Japan. This event is being produced by NJPW’s Hiromu Takahashi and will air live on New Japan World.
In regards to the actual match order for the event, NJPW announced that it is being kept as a surprise for fans attending and will only be revealed as the wrestlers make their entrances for their scheduled matches. The only exception being the main event was announced to be a singles match of Master Wato vs. Atsuki Aoyagi.
- Master Wato vs. Atsuki Aoyagi
- Five-way match – Taiji Ishimori vs. Soberano Jr. vs. Shun Skywalker vs. Ninja Mack vs. YO-HEY
- Mistico, Billy Ken Kid, Alejandro, & Gurukun Mask vs. Dragon Kid, BUSHI, Atlantis Jr., & Black Mensore
- Three-way Tag Team match – El Desperado & Volador Jr. vs. El Lindaman & Yuuki Ueno vs. Los Japoneses Del Mal (DOUKI & HANAOKA)
- Ryusuke Taguchi, Hikaru Sato, & Yumehito Imanari vs. Great Sasuke, Tigers Mask, & Batten Burabura
- Support Shinjiro Otani match – Tatsuhito Takaiwa, Yoshinobu Kanemaru, Jun Kasai, Minoru Tanaka, & TAKA Michinoku vs. MUSASHI, Shoki Kitamura, LEONA, Chicharito Shoki, & Kota Sekifuda
- Isami Kodaka & Mao vs. SHO & Onryo
- Hiromu Takahashi, Fujita “Jr.” Hayato, & AMAKUSA vs. HAYATA, YAMATO, & Kazuki Hashimoto
